Working Principle of Oil-Free Compressors

Oil-Free Compressors operate on the principle of using dry compression chambers, which prevent any contact between the compressed air and oil. Instead of oil lubrication, they utilize advanced technologies such as dry screws or scroll compression mechanisms to produce compressed air without oil contamination.

Installation of Oil-Free Compressors

Proper installation of Oil-Free Compressors is crucial to ensure optimal performance and longevity. Follow the manufacturer’s guidelines and consider the following key steps:

  1. 1. Choose an appropriate location for the compressor with adequate ventilation.
  2. 2. Install necessary air filters and dryers to maintain air quality.
  3. 3. Connect the compressor to power and ensure proper grounding.
  4. 4. Verify correct piping layout and connections for compressed air distribution.
  5. 5. Perform initial startup and follow the startup procedure provided by the manufacturer.
